Power companies seek Rs3.16 per unit hike in electricity tariff for March

April 20, 2022 (MLN): Central Power Purchasing Agency (CPPA) has proposed an increase of Rs3.16/kWh in the electricity tariff over the reference fuel charges of Rs6.23/kWh under fuel price adjustment for the month of March 2022 for Ex-WAPDA Discos.

In this regard, a public hearing to consider the proposed adjustment will be held on April 27, 2022, by NEPRA in which all interested or affected parties are invited to raise objections as permissible under the law.

As per the petition, submitted by CPPA with National Electric Power Regulatory Authority (NEPRA), the total energy generated in March 2022 was 10,418.4 GWh at a total price of Rs96,032 million which was Rs9.2176 per unit.

Of this, about 10,078.7 GWh were sold to the Discos at Rs94,608 million. Total electricity sold to IPPs was 33.78 GWh, for Rs1,193 million while the reduction in transmission losses were recorded at 305.91 GWh.
